Whitney Houston’s Role in ‘The Princess Diaries’
Whitney Houston, renowned for her unparalleled vocal prowess, extended her creative reach into film production. Through her company, Brownhouse Productions, she played a pivotal role in creating the beloved teen film, “The Princess Diaries,” in 2001. This project marked Whitney’s debut as a feature film producer, a milestone following her success with “Rodgers & Hammerstein’s Cinderella” in 1997 and preceding her involvement in “Cheetah Girls” in 2003.
A multi-talented artist with numerous awards, including eight Grammys, Whitney’s venture into cinema diversified her portfolio. “The Princess Diaries” remains a shining example of her versatility, immortalizing her impact beyond the music scene in a cherished teen classic.
